Output 121b0832694f0ea57459ae84a5149f2e39b71379688cfc405ed057a876a88174:0

value
17535216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fffebc194bc47cfa48e93d4a913ef64dcac929e OP_EQUAL
address
MRQMsmTDo9dKQ8hYixborCuh7LbcpapbuE
transaction
121b0832694f0ea57459ae84a5149f2e39b71379688cfc405ed057a876a88174
spent
true